Subject: Bounce processor cut-over complete

Team — the switch from the legacy Mailwright bounce handler to the new Pelicanloop processor finished last night. All suppression-list writes now flow through the new queue, and the legacy consumer is drained and stopped. Replay of the six-hour backlog completed without duplicates. Please review the diff against the staging branch before we tag the release. The processor is now running with the following configuration.

settings of fafog-haduf:
ZORIX_PIN=4648
ZORIX_METRICS_HOST=metrics.zorix.paliqsys.corp
ZORIX_LOG_LEVEL=info
ZORIX_TENANT=druix

# Break-Glass: Fernwick SDK Parity Console

The parity dashboard compares the Fernwick Kotlin and Swift SDK feature matrices. If the comparison job deadlocks mid-release, reviewers may use break-glass access to force a re-sync. This is logged and reviewed weekly. Authenticate to the parity console with the recovery passphrase below.

recovery phrase for fawif-tajeg: norael-aldmir-casir-brivan-ulaion

**ALERT: Payroll export format changed**

The Marrowfield payroll export switched from fixed-width to delimited records this cycle. Downstream jobs expecting the old layout will fail parsing. Do not re-run failed exports manually; the converter handles backfill. New joiners: read the migration notes first. The format spec is on the internal page below.

wiki page, yafop-fadup: https://jira.qorvelsys.internal/projects/display/projects/pages

Facilities ticket — Halewick Tower, night shift.

Issue: support team reporting east stairwell reader rejecting badges after midnight. Reader was reset this morning; firmware updated. Overnight crew should now badge as normal. If the reader fails again, use the manual keypad by the fire door — do not prop the door. Log any further failures with the time and badge name. Temporary keypad code for the fallback door is below.

door code, tajeg-fawip: bdg-K-62